Create a Sierra Account for a Staff Member

New accounts can be modeled after another employee with similar access authorization in order to eliminate numerous steps in assigning permissions.

 

  • Sign into the Sierra Administration Application at https://consort.library.denison.edu:63100/sierra/admin

  • Under User Accounts, select Authorizations and Authentication.

  • Click Create User at the top right

  • Under the Basic Info tab, complete the following:

    • Within the Name field, enter the employee’s initials, beginning with the initial of the associated school (e.g. John Q. Public at Wooster would be entered as “wjqp”).

    • Within the Full Name field, enter the 3-letter code for the school and the employee’s full name (e.g. “WOO John Public”).

    • In the Password and Confirm Password fields, enter a temporary password that the employee will use to sign in for the first time. Note: the password is limited to 8 characters.

    • Select the User Group and Accounting Unit that is appropriate for the employee and school (e.g. “WOO Staff” and “4 WOOST”).

    • The remaining fields in the Create New User section can be left in the default status.

    • Click SAVE at the bottom right.

  • Select Permissions from the horizontal toolbar (to the right of the Basic Info tab). This is where you can assign permissions for the user.

    • In order to model permissions after another user, select Import Settings at the top right.

    • Select a user or user type by entering a name in the filter field, or making a selection from the list below.

    • Once a similar user is selected, check the box(es) next to the section(s) to be imported (this will usually be everything).

    • Click Import Settings.

  • Click SAVE at the bottom right.

  • Send an email to the employee with their login information and instructions. This should include:

    • The username (e.g. wjqp)

    • The temporary password generated above.

    • Include instructions for installing the Sierra Desktop Application.

    • Be sure to encourage the employee to change the password upon their first login by clicking Admin > Change Password in the toolbar within Sierra.

  • Provide contact information in case there are questions.
